**14:22** — Ondra confirmed the flaky assertions in the Tollgate payments suite correlate with clock skew on the shared fixture host, not with the retry middleware as first suspected. Three reruns passed after pinning NTP. We quarantined `test_settlement_window` pending a proper fix. If the flake recurs on your shift, capture the failing run and note the trace token printed below.

build token for yajof-bajof: htk31_506ff1188f74596b5bb2eec94edc43c

# Break-Glass: Catalog Cache Invalidation

Scope: the Pinrow product catalog at Veldstone Retail. If stale prices persist after a purge and the Hollowmere invalidation queue is wedged, use break-glass to flush the edge tier directly. Contractors: get verbal sign-off from the catalog lead first. Steps: open the Hollowmere admin shell, select emergency-flush, confirm the tenant, and run it once — repeated flushes thrash the origin. Access is logged and expires after 20 minutes. Unseal the admin shell with the passphrase below.

recovery phrase for kahop-tajog: istix-casvan

Action item: The Relayn deploy-status bot silently dropped updates when the pipeline API paginated results, so responders believed a rollback had completed when it had not. We will add pagination handling, a staleness banner, and an integration test. Until merged, verify deploy state directly in the pipeline console, documented at the page below.

runbook for kahop-kajop: https://rundeck.ordinio.test/display/secrets/pipeline/issue/pages/repo/browse/e5732776e07d1285107e5aeb

## Onboarding: Farebranch Rules Engine

Plugin authors integrate with Farebranch by registering fee rules against the evaluation API. Rules are sandboxed; they cannot perform network calls directly. All rate-table lookups go through the host, which validates your plugin manifest at load time. Your local env file must include the signing credential the host uses to verify manifests, set on the next line.

secret setting of bajef-fajof: COURIER_KEY3=76c